Abstract

An interactive flat panel display is provided with an integrated document camera, embedded computer, and additional touch screen panel in one complete system that facilitates an engaging, interactive and collaborative learning experience. The embedded computer and/or document camera provides content to the flat panel display and the additional touch screen display thereby allowing the user to interact with programs, computer applications, websites, etc. through the touch screen capabilities of the displays.

Claims

1. An interactive flat panel display (IFPD) device comprising: flat panel display comprising a first interactive touch screen; a portable mounting apparatus supporting the flat panel display; a podium structurally coupled to the portable mounting apparatus; a computer structurally coupled to the portable mounting apparatus, wherein the computer comprises a second interactive touch screen and is electronically coupled to the flat panel display; and wherein the computer provides content to the flat panel display and synchronizes display on the first interactive touch screen and display on the second interactive touch screen.

2. The IFPD device of claim 1, wherein a height of the flat panel display is adjustable via the portable mounting apparatus.

3. The IFPD device of claim 1, wherein the podium is pivotable about a horizontal and vertical axis.

4. The IFPD device of claim 1, further comprising an image capture device electronically coupled to the computer.

5. The IFPD device of claim 4, wherein the image capture device is a document camera.

6. The IFPD device of claim 1, wherein the second interactive touch screen is located within the podium and is configured to interact with content on the flat panel display.

7. The IFPD device of claim 1, wherein the portable mounting apparatus comprises wheels.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F EMBODIMENTS

[0017] Further features and advantages of the invention, as well as the structure and operation of various embodiments of the invention, are described in detail below with reference to the accompanying FIGS. 1-5, wherein like reference numerals refer to like elements.

[0018] FIGS. 1A and 1B illustrate a front, rear, top, and side view of a fully integrated IFPD device with the podium surface in a retracted and extended position, respectively, according to an embodiment of the invention. FIG. 1A illustrates multiple views of the fully integrated IFPD device 100. The fully integrated IFPD device 110 includes a flat panel display 111, which can be any flat panel display with touch screen capabilities known to one of ordinary skill in the art. In an alternative embodiment, the flat panel display 110 may be any pre-existing flat panel display and fitted with an interactive display overlay known to one of ordinary skill in the art. For example, any LCD or plasma television may be converted to an IFPD by overlaying the television panel with an interactive display overlay.

[0019] The IFPD device of the present invention is portable and may include wheels 115. A podium surface 119 is connected to the IFPD device by a hinged suspension arm having at least one hinge. The IFPD 110 includes a hinged suspension arm 116 having hinge 117 and hinge 118 both rotatable 360 degrees about a vertical axis. Hinges 117 and 118 allow the podium surface 119 to be extended away from the IFPD device and in an orientation adjustable to the user's preference. The rear view of the fully integrated IFPD device 120, illustrates a mounting apparatus 125 for the flat panel display 111. The flat panel display 111 is adjustable upwardly and downwardly with respect to a horizontal axis via a vertical telescoping arm 126. The adjustable upward and downward movement of the flat panel display can be accomplished by any device know to one of skill in the art that allows the flat panel display to adjusted upwardly and downwardly and locked into position. For example, 126 may be a slide with locking mechanism, a hydraulic lift, cranking mechanism, and the like. The side and top views of the fully integrated IFPD device are illustrated at 130A, 130B, and 140 respectively.

[0020] FIG. 1B illustrates the fully integrated IFPD device with the podium surface in an extended position. The rear view of the fully integrated IFPD device 120 illustrates the podium surface 142, the second touch screen panel 143, and the image capture device 144. The second touch screen panel 143 is connected to an embedded computer (not shown). In a preferred embodiment of the invention, the computer is any computer integrated with or electronically coupled to a touchscreen interface with an operating system such as Apple iOS, Microsoft Windows, or Google Android, among others, the implementation of which are readily apparent to one of ordinary skill in the art. The second touch screen panel 143 can be any display panel with touch screen capabilities. In some embodiments, the second touch screen panel is itself a computer, laptop, tablet, etc. with touch screen capabilities. In this embodiment, an embedded computer is not required as the second touch screen panel provides the computing hardware and software necessary to operate the fully integrated IFPD device. Regardless, the embedded computer synchronizes the display on the flat panel display 111 and any other display such as the display on the second touch screen panel 143. That way a user can see the same display via the second touch screen panel (in the podium) as that displayed on the flat panel display 111 (e.g., behind the user).

[0021] The side views, 130A and 130B, and top view 140 provide alternate views of the fully integrated IFPD device including the podium surface 142, the second touch screen panel 143, the image capture device 144, and the extended hinged suspension arm 116 with hinge 117 facilitating the extension of the podium surface 142 away from the flat panel display 111. The top view of the fully integrated IFPD device 140 also illustrates the podium surface 142 in an orientation about hinge 118 of the extended hinged suspension arm 116. In this orientation, the podium surface 142 is in a position away from the viewing area of the flat panel display 111.

[0024] FIG. 4 illustrates the podium surface with integrated second touch screen panel and image display device according to an embodiment of the invention. The podium surface 142 may include a plurality of integrated devices. For purposes of this description, the podium surface 142 will be described with respect to two devices: a second touch screen panel 143 and an image capture device 144. The second touch screen panel 143 may be integrated with the podium surface 142 and capable of being raised (as seen in 410) relative to the top surface of the podium surface 142. In a closed position, the touch screen panel 143 may be level with the top surface of the podium surface 142 or below the level of the top surface of the podium surface 142. The image capture device 144 may be an image capture device such as a document camera with an adjustable arm (with one or two pivot points) such as those disclosed in U.S. Pat. Nos. D715,300 and D677,707, which can be modified to be integrated with the podium surface 142. In an alternative embodiment, the image capture device 144 is removably attached to the podium surface 142.

[0025] In an embodiment of the invention, the image capture device 144 comprises a document camera the can magnify and project the video image of documents and three-dimensional objects placed on the podium surface 142. In an exemplary embodiment of the invention, the document camera comprises optics, camera, an optional lighting system, and a motherboard with appropriate firmware. Simple or highly complex optical system can be used. The camera preferably a progressive scan camera, e.g., a charge-coupled device (CCD) sensor or complementary metal-oxide semiconductor (CMOS) sensor, to provide high-resolution color images at thirty (30) frames per second or more. A lighting system may be used to illuminate the writing surface. The motherboard may have a variety of connections to output video such as HDMI, DVI, VGA, USB, and/or LAN, the implementation of which are apparent to one of ordinary skill in the art. The document camera may also be equipped with wireless technology such as, but not limited to WIFI to eliminate the need for cables. The term document camera as used herein means a device as noted above that can direct its camera toward the podium surface, preferably from vertically overhead the podium surface.

[0026] An advantage of the present invention is that the fully integrated nature of the image display device, embedded computer, and second touch screen panel allows the cables of all devices to be concealed within the hinged suspension arm and mounting apparatus of the device thereby hidden from view. In an embodiment of the invention, the image display device, embedded computer, and second touch screen panel communicate with each other and the flat panel display wirelessly, for example, via IEEE 802 protocol, Bluetooth, or ZigBee. The document camera 144 can acquire video via the embedded computer (or alternatively the second touch screen panel acting itself as a computer, laptop, tablet, etc.) as described in U.S. Pat. No. 8,508,751, the entire disclosure of which is incorporated by reference herein. The embedded computer provides a platform for interactive learning applications (or “apps”) to run, access to a network, and/or teaching modules. These apps may include, but are not limited to: digital text books, a classroom response system, test facilitators, social networking apps, email, homework submission apps, productivity apps, and cloud server apps (for enabling, for example, online storage, bookmarking in text books, etc.).
